manual-coffee-grinder-unifun-burr-coffee-crinder-stainless-steel-with-adjustable-ceramic-conical-burr-hand-crank-mill-compact-size-perfect-for-your-home-office-or-travelling-17226.jpgAn Industrial Coffee Grinder Is a Powerful Workhorse

An industrial coffee grinder is an extremely powerful machine that can handle huge volumes of beans. It has a motor with high torque and larger burrs that can grind faster. It has a cooling system to stop the beans from being scorched by the heat.

The weight-based dose system makes sure that the right amount of ground is delivered every time. It is also designed for nonstop grinding, with temperature-controlled burrs that keep the grinder running continuously.

The best industrial coffee mills are designed with consistency and long-term durability in mind. They are ideal for businesses that need to grind large quantities of coffee to sell in their cafes, restaurants and coffee shops. They also need to be capable of grinding coffee quickly and efficiently. They use burr grinders with conical or flat burrs. These grinders have abrasive surface that crushes the beans into uniform sizes of particles. They are more precise than blades grinders. They are also more durable compared to home models.

When choosing an industrial coffee grinder it is essential to take into consideration the size and design of your business. The dimensions and style of your grinder will determine how much it can grind at a time, and the type of container it can hold. Some grinders can hold hoppers which are attached to containers, while others have a built-in container for the ground coffee.

It is essential to study the various types of commercial grinders before deciding the right model. The most well-known brands are Ditting and Mahlkonig. Both brands offer a variety of grinders ranging from small countertop models to larger commercial grinders. Consult a professional if you're not sure which grinder will work best for your business.

However, it's important to keep in mind that the machine could be dangerous if not properly maintained. It is therefore essential to maintain the grinder in good working order and clean it frequently.

To clean your industrial grinder, disconnect the hopper first, then remove the top burr. Depending on the model, this may involve turning and lifting the burr, or the release of clips that hold it in place. After the burrs have been removed and cleaned, you can clean the inside of your grinder with a brush or an air compressor.

To maintain the quality of your coffee grounds You should also invest in a top-quality burr set. They are available in conical or flat designs, and both types have their own benefits. Conical burr sets generate bimodal coffee particles, which boosts the more vibrant and fruity flavor of the beans. Flat burrs will produce more uniform particles.

A commercial grinder with a good reputation has a hopper that holds the entire beans to be ground and the mechanism for grinding is situated above it. This design allows for easy access and stops the heat generated by the grinder from spreading to the beans.

The majority of commercial coffee grinders employ two burrs that grind the whole bean into smaller pieces. The burrs are sharp, tooth-like grooves which break the coffee into small pieces. One burr is powered by a large electric motor and moves at high speeds (revolutions per minute (also known as RPM). The other burr is stationary.

The top industrial coffee grinders will come with many grind settings to suit different types of brewing techniques. These grinders feature grinding discs made of wear-resistant stainless steel. They also stay cool when in use to help preserve the flavor of the coffee.

It is durable

Many commercial grinders are built to run continuously, which implies that they need a durable design that can stand up to the demands of daily use. The Model GPX from Modern Process Equipment is designed with this in mind. It features 5.5-inch diameter "diamond hard" grinding discs that have been precisely cut to maximize cutting performance and ensure an even grind for constant brewing performance. The machine has two cooling fans to cool the grinding discs.

The hopper can hold a lot of ground coffee, and it has an locking mechanism to avoid spills. The GPX is easy to clean and maintain. It's perfect for coffee shops that sell pre-ground beans. It also has a fine grinding adjustment wheel that makes it easy to switch between different levels of consistency.

Mahlkonig EK43 is another popular choice. This robust machine is able to handle large amounts of coffee. The burrs are made of hardened steel that is resistant to wear and tear for long-lasting use.
